    A nacelle (/ n ə ˈ s ɛ l / nə-SEL) is a streamlined container for aircraft parts such as engines, fuel or equipment. [1] When attached entirely outside the airframe, it is sometimes called a pod, in which case it is attached with a pylon or strut and the engine is known as a podded engine . [ 2 ]

    A nacelle / n ə ˈ s ɛ l / is a cover housing that houses all of the generating components in a wind turbine, including the generator, gearbox, drive train, and brake assembly. [ 1 ]
